Output 89a11c3b9869ca557d32791b0cc3801ca7da1eb94a2b53e87989c4a5c584f845:0

value
53690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52baa58a490d4b8513ebb9aec523e5feed0ce81f OP_EQUAL
address
39ESvi89k2zHA1TyBgPVpEt8iTxCyywVHM
transaction
89a11c3b9869ca557d32791b0cc3801ca7da1eb94a2b53e87989c4a5c584f845
confirmations
208734
spent
true